摘要
Generalizing a conventional phase-shifted pilot (PSP) sequences and discrete Fourier Transform (DFT) based channel estimator to MIMO-OFDM systems with virtual subcarriers, this paper presents two enhanced channel estimators applying Wiener interpolation and smoothing. Simulation results show that the proposed schemes can almost eliminate the mean square error floor of the conventional PSP/DFT-based channel estimator and improve the channel estimation accuracy further in some cases. Additionally, the application of a robust channel correlation matrix estimator avoids the complicated measurement of channel statistical properties and thus makes die proposed schemes more feasible in practical systems.
